Copenhagen Junior Senior High School (Closed 2023)

3020 Mechanic Street
Copenhagen, NY 13626
Copenhagen Junior Senior High School serves 305 students in grades 7-12. 
Minority enrollment was 2% of the student body (majority Black and Hispanic), which was lower than the New York state average of 60% (majority Hispanic).
